Seven-time champion Rafael Nadal is through to the third round of the Internazionali BNL d’Italia after a 6-2 6-0 win over Marsel Ilhan of Turkey. The match lasted 74 minutes as Rafa scored his first win over the Turk.
Rafa: “Today was a good start. I played with not many mistakes and that gave me the chance to win with that score.”
